Antke Engel
Antke Engel is a philosopher focusing on feminist and poststructuralist theory, on conceptualizations of sexuality and desire, and on the critique of representation. She received her Ph.D. in Philosophy at Potsdam University in 2001. In her dissertation she analyzes the use of concepts of sex, gender and sexuality in queer theoretical approaches and she proposes a ’strategy of equivocation’ as a means of queer/feminist politics of representation. Between 2003 and 2005 she held a visiting professorship for Queer Theory at Hamburg University. During this time she organized three workshops, which provided for queer theoretical and political exchange of European, including many Eastern European, queer scholars. Apart from extensive teaching experience and public lecturing, Antke Engel has also been engaged as an activist, a cultural worker, and a magazine publisher for many years believing in the mutual inspiration of theory and politics. During a research fellowship at the Institute for Queer Theory (ici-Berlin) (2007-2009) she wrote her most recent book on queer cultural politics under neoliberal conditions entitled "Bilder von Sexualität und Ökonomie". Typical of Antke Engel's academic work is a readiness to confront and connect social and cultural theory, particularly affirming deconstructive approaches in the critique of systems of domination. She is interested in cultural representations, especially visual representations in media, film, and art, focusing on queering practices and their socio-political effects.
